¿Hay una alternativa a MySQL?

19

Me gustaría una base de datos liviana para mi RaspPi liviana. MySQL parece un poco exagerado e implica demasiada administración. Necesitaré uno con una API perl.

CPRitter
fuente
¿Crees que las respuestas a esta pregunta serán completamente subjetivas?
Jivings
@Jivings No estoy seguro de lo que estás preguntando. ¿Creo que las personas solo darán opiniones y no hechos? Si otros dan preferencias en sus respuestas, ¿a quién le importa? Mientras sean fácticos y al grano, me interesa.
CPRitter
Estoy diciendo que la respuesta a esta pregunta podría basarse en gran medida en la preferencia personal. Todo lo que significa es que debemos vigilarlo más de cerca para asegurarnos de que las respuestas estén respaldadas por hechos.
Jivings

Respuestas:

25

¡Estás de suerte! Deberías probar SQLite. SQLite es muy ligero e implementa un gran subconjunto de SQL. Toda su base de datos se almacena en un solo archivo. Y hay una API perl. Aquí hay un enlace a la página de inicio de SQLite ...

SQLite

Para instalar solo SQLite ...

sudo apt-get install sqlite

Para instalar la API perl y SQLite (no es necesario lo anterior) ...

sudo apt-get install libdbd-sqlite3-perl

Es posible que desee considerar DBD :: CSV en su lugar (o también) ...

sudo apt-get install libdbd-csv-perl
CPRitter
fuente
1
Creo que esta respuesta debería enumerar más que solo SQLite. Hay muchas soluciones
Jivings
1
Algunos comentarios sobre las limitaciones de SQLite en comparación con MySQL también serían geniales.
Krzysztof Adamski